Gross monthly income works out to about $4,121,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,236/mo in rent. Palm Beach's median rent of $8,999 exceeds that threshold by $7,763/mo, putting a paramedic salary into the rent-burdened range here. A paramedic works roughly 378.5 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and a paramedic salary

Paramedic and EMT base pay sits modestly below the US median household income and is often supplemented by overtime. At the national-average paramedic salary, the 30% rule supports about $1,330 a month in r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Florida state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Palm Beach, FL.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
